Amsterdam railcar 465, manufacturer Beijnes, type 3G, signed line 20.
Amsterdam railcar 507 (ex Rotterdam railcar 507), manufacturer Werkspoor, type 11G, manufactured 1929-1931, signed line 16, in the direction of Oudeduk.
Amsterdam railcar 4143 (ex Vienna railcar 4143), manufacturer Simmering, type M, signed line 5, in the direction of Ejderschplatz.
Amsterdam railcar 401, manufacturer Werkspoor, type 2-axle motor car, signed line 17.

On Sunday 21 April 2013 I visited the Electric Museum Tram Line Amsterdam (EMA).
This tram line runs from the Haarlemmermeer station in Amsterdam to Bovenkerk in Amstelveen. The tram line has a very rural character.
To get an impression of the line I first rode along from the Haarlemmermeer station to the end point Bovenkerk and walked back from there to the Kalfjeslaan, where an attempt was made to record as many rides as possible at various locations. At the Kalfjeslaan stop I got back on the museum tram to go back to the Haarlemmermeer station.
The recordings are grouped per tram as much as possible.
